How to Stay Safe During Monday's Severe Weather:

Preparation is key to minimizing the risks associated with severe weather. Here are some crucial steps to take:

  1. Stay Informed: Continuously monitor weather reports from the NWS and local news outlets. Sign up for weather alerts on your phone.
  2. Secure Your Property: Bring loose outdoor objects inside, secure anything that could become airborne, and trim any overhanging branches.
  3. Prepare an Emergency Kit: Have a kit readily available with essential supplies like water, non-perishable food, flashlights, batteries, and a first-aid kit.
  4. Know Your Shelter Plan: Identify a safe room in your home – ideally an interior room on the lowest level – where you can take shelter during severe weather. Understand your community's warning systems.
  5. Charge Your Devices: Ensure your cell phone and other electronic devices are fully charged in case of power outages.
